Chris Bloomstran, CFA
Topic: Value Investing   
 
Value Investing is the purchase and ownership of securities that appear undervalued using various forms of fundamental analysis. In the world of common stocks, Value Investing involves buying stocks for less than their intrinsic value. The discount that exists to intrinsic value provides a “margin of safety”. Warren Buffett, the Chairman and CEO of Berkshire Hathaway, is the most recognized disciple of the school of Value Investing. Most of the great long-term stock market investing track records have been produced by individuals or firms practicing the value discipline of investing. The presentation will involve an example of Value Investing at work.
 
Michael Pompian, CFA 
Topic: Behavioral Finance  
Most investors act irrationally in some way. Behavioral Finance attempts to understand and explain why investor make irrational investment decisions. This talk will give you insights into behavioral biases and how you can make better investment decisions.
